Transaction 85fb566981af612e5c3cb751b9295d18bdf3f6015526c7d2d82ba11d4def1c5c
1 Input
1 Output
-
85fb566981af612e5c3cb751b9295d18bdf3f6015526c7d2d82ba11d4def1c5c:0
- value
- 12382
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4e0b581636541361aad6df4cb668eeb14ccc4c3b OP_EQUAL
- address
- 38ogDhzmR5UDjK9s3WQfnoYJFZrT6AWsdB